jayhawker definition

jay·hawker (hôk′ər)

noun

  1. an abolitionist guerrilla of Missouri and Kansas in Civil War days
  2. a robber, raider, or plunderer
  3. Informal a person born or living in Kansas
    also Jayhawk Jay′·hawk′

Etymology: < ?
